Eu Food Supplements Directive
EDM number 1211 in 2001-02, proposed by Liam Fox on 29/04/2002.
That this House expresses its concern that, despite the recent welcome amendment of Article 4, the EU Food Supplements Directive will lead to an over-restrictive regulation of food supplements resulting in many popular and important substances with a long history of safe use not being available in the United Kingdom; particularly notes that the use of reference intakes of vitamins and minerals for the population are likely to lead to an inappropriately low upper safety level; and calls on the Government vigorously to defend United Kingdom consumers' and manufacturers' interests.
This motion has been signed by a total of 98 MPs.
